Ticket #4412 — QuotaForge signature check failing on tenant rate-quota sync. Since the 3.2 rollout, the per-tenant quota manifest pushed from the Larkspan control plane fails verification on all edge nodes, so quota updates are silently dropped and tenants keep stale limits. We confirmed the manifest itself is well-formed; the verifier is simply rejecting the signature. Support should pin affected tenants to cached quotas until the fix ships. For verification during triage, use the current signing key below.

release key, fahaf-bajof: bky3_Xam

## Step 4: Tune GC for Matchwell

Heads up: after upgrading Matchwell to 3.2, the matching service's heap churns way harder during peak pairing runs, so the old GC settings cause multi-second pauses. We've moved to the pause-target collector and bumped the young-gen sizing. Before you sign off the release, apply the new values below.

deployment values, yadug-bawif:
[framir]
team = pelox
access_code = ac_a38ab2
owner = tamion.julael
host = framir.tolvaqlabs.test
port = 11211
peer = tammir.zemvargrid.local
salt = 2215ef03
pin = 1541

// Deep-link route table for the Wrenpath mobile app.
// Support team: this constant maps inbound link prefixes to in-app
// screens. Unrecognized prefixes fall back to the home screen rather
// than erroring, so "link does nothing" reports usually mean a stale
// prefix from an old campaign. Do not edit this table by hand; it is
// generated at build time. The generating build is recorded below.

session token of tajef-bageg = htk21_5d90d574934f3ccae6437